to_csv() # 将DataFrame存为csv格式。 DataFrame.to_csv(path_or_buf=None,sep=',',na_rep='',float_format=None,columns=None,header=True,index=True,index_label=None,mode='w',encoding=None,compression='infer',quoting=None,quotechar='"',line_terminator=None,chunksize=None,date_format=None,doub...
.to_csv 方法是 Pandas 中用于将 DataFrame 对象导出为 CSV 文件的常用方法。如果你发现 .to_csv 方法没有正确地将数据导出到 CSV 文件,可能是以下几个原因导致的: 基础概念 CSV(Comma-Separated Values)是一种常见的文件格式,用于存储表格数据,每行代表一条记录,每列代表一个字段,字段之间用逗号分隔。 可...
列名错误:CSV和Excel文件要求每列都有唯一的列名。如果某列的列名与其他列重复,就会导致列格式错误。解决方法是确保每列都有唯一的列名,可以使用pandas的rename方法重命名列名。 总结起来,当使用pandas的to_csv和to_excel方法导出数据时,如果遇到列格式错误,需要检查数据类型、缺失值、特殊字符和列名等方面的问题,并...
sep="|", na_rep="NaN")#|something|a|b|c|d|message#0|one|1|2|3.0|4|NaN#1|two|5|6|NaN|8|world#2|three|9|10|11.0|12|foodata.to_csv(sys.stdout, index=False, header=False)#one,1,2,3.0,4,#two,5,6,,
PandasDataFrame.to_csv(~)方法将源 DataFrame 转换为逗号分隔值格式。 参数 1.path_or_buf|string或file handle|optional 写入csv 的路径。默认情况下,csv 以字符串形式返回。 2.sep|string长度为 1 |optional 要使用的分隔符。默认情况下,sep=","。
Python的Pandas库提供了非常方便的函数来将DataFrame数据输出为多种格式的文件,包括CSV、TXT和XLSX等。下面,我们将详细介绍如何使用Pandas库来实现这些功能。 1. 输出为CSV文件 CSV(Comma Separated Values)是一种常用的数据交换格式,它使用逗号作为字段之间的分隔符。Pandas提供了to_csv函数来将DataFrame保存为CSV文件。
使用to_csv()方法导出并保存csv文件 仅导出特定列:参数columns 有/无标头,索引:参数header,index 编码:参数encoding 分隔符:参数sep 写入模式(新建,覆盖,添加):参数mode float浮点格式:参数float_format 转换为任何格式并保存 读取csv文件请参阅以下文章。
使用pandas中的to_csv将数据写入csv格式的文件 1 2 3 4 5 6 7 8 9 10 11 import pandas as pd import numpy as np '''第一种写法:当值都是list类型的数据''' data1 = {'A':range(3),'B':list("abc"),'C':['red',np.NaN,'yellow']} df1=pd.DataFrame(data1) '''第二种写法:当值...
encoding文件的编码格式(如utf-8,latin1等)None 读取nba.csv 文件数据: 实例 importpandasaspd df=pd.read_csv('nba.csv') print(df.to_string()) to_string()用于返回 DataFrame 类型的数据,如果不使用该函数,则输出结果为数据的前面 5 行和末尾 5 行,中间部分以...代替。
从表格可以看出,CSV格式文件是文本格式,而Excel文件则是二进制格式,选择这两中文件格式也算是非常具有代表性了。 CSV文件操作 按教程应该先教读再教写,不过我这刚好有这个表格,我先把它存成CSV文件看看。 to_csv()写文件 只有一行,参数就是路径和文件名,如果不指定路径它会存在当前目录(但愿你还能记得当前路径,...